Summary:This study sought to provide current and updated information on knowledge, skills, experience, and educational qualifications needed for marketing research personnel in today's dynamic marketplace. Classified ads for marketing research positions are identified as key sources of information on competencies and qualifications, because they represent a current snapshot of labor market needs. The ultimate objective is to enhance current understanding of the profession and its needs, so that appropriate programs for professional development and training, education, recruitment, and placement of marketing research professionals can be created and implemented. Technical skills were found to be vital at the junior level; however, job candidates and trainees must remain cognizant of their long-term career goals. These demand that job competence be maintained with sound communication and interpersonal skills. Interestingly, even senior management personnel must not ignore the research skills set.
